Drink 0-0, Neal Martin, Mar 2024

The 2014 Ferrière has a perfumed nose with violet-tinged red fruit, incense and earthy tones. There might just be a touch of TCA here. The palate is definitely corked. Tasted non-blind at the Southwold 10-Year-On tasting.

Score 15.5/20 · Drink 2021-2028, Jancis Robinson MW, Nov 2018

68% Cabernet Sauvignon, 30% Merlot, 2% Cabernet Franc . Tasted blind. Very light nose and then drying, rustic finish. Rather ordinary. (JR)

Score 88/100 · Drink 2019-2032, Neal Martin, Mar 2018

The 2014 Ferrière has a backward bouquet with brambly black fruit, graphite, pressed violets and cedar aromas that gather pace with aeration. The palate is medium-bodied with fine tannin. It just feels a little muddled on the finish compared to its peers. Tasted blind at the annual Southwold tasting.

Score 16.5/20 · Drink 2023-2035, Jancis Robinson MW, Feb 2018

Tasted blind. Deep crimson. Some richness and perfume. Rather too emphatic for classic Margaux but it’s flattering and easy to like. Dry finish with sandpaper tannins for the moment. (JR)
